Hi, Amihay,

Internally, FastBit tracks the data partitions by name.  It appears
that you have given the two partitions exactly the same name (and the
two partitions also happen have the same number of rows and same
number of columns).  FastBit suspects that you have given the same
data partition twice and therefore is telling you that it will only
use one of them.  Here are a couple of suggestions to work around this
problem.

- given each data partition a different name yourself.
- give no name to any of the partitions, in which case, the name of
the directory will be used - and therefore each partition will have a
different name
- I could add something else to the test of whether the new partition
is the same as an existing one, which might take a while to happen..

Let me know if you would rather that I take the last option and feel
free to suggest something..

>     Hi, Amihay,
> 
>     Glad to see that you are getting it to work.
> 
>     The function that recursively visit all subdirectories is using
>     opendir which is not available on windows environment - at least not
>     the way I am using them..  You will need to explicitly name each data
>     directory on the command through the -d option or listing the data
>     directories in a RC file.
